Who might be able to join this trial:

  • People aged 18 or older, of any gender
  • People who have been diagnosed with colorectal cancer confirmed by laboratory tissue testing, at stage II (TNM classification)
  • People who had surgery to fully remove the colorectal cancer (called R0 resection) within the 12 weeks before enrolling in the trial
  • People who did not receive any treatment before or after their surgery prior to joining the trial
  • People with a general health and activity level rated at 0–2 on the ECOG scale (a medical scoring system for physical functioning — confirm with trial site)
  • People whose situation meets the Chinese clinical guidelines (CSCO 2022) for receiving a single-drug after-surgery treatment called capecitabine
  • People who are alert, able to communicate clearly, and able to read and complete questionnaires
  • People who agree to take part voluntarily and sign a consent form

Who may not be able to join:

  • People whose cancer is located in the lower part of the rectum, within 12 centimetres of the anal opening
  • People who have a history of any other type of cancer
  • People with a known allergy to Huaier granules, or for whom this product is advised to be avoided or used with caution (this applies to the experimental group only)
  • People who are unable to swallow or take oral (by mouth) medications
  • People who are pregnant, breastfeeding, or planning to become pregnant
  • People who have taken Huaier granules, or traditional Chinese medicines with similar uses, in the month before joining the trial (examples listed in the trial documents include compound cantharides capsules, cinobufacin capsules, Kangai injection, and Pingxiao tablets — confirm with trial site for a full list)
  • People who are unwilling to attend follow-up appointments
  • People whom the trial researchers consider unsuitable for other reasons (confirm with trial site)
